When is the optimal time of year for tree pruning?
The optimal timing for pruning will certainly vary depending on the sort of tree and where you are located. In general, it's best to have a tree pruner cut back your trees during the dormant time of year.
Winter is a good time for tree maintenance due to the fact that the remainder of your backyard should not need any type of focus during that time. Thinning trees prior to the springtime sprouting and growing season will allow your trees to shoot out and flourish nicely.
There is normally no problem doing tree upkeep throughout the springtime and summertime too, especially if there is any kind of d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Pruning
Palm trees require a good deal of care when pruning. Cutting the limbs at the wrong time can leave them defenseless against diseases. Palm trees ought to be pruned when the older growth has turned brown and died. This is generally one or two times in a year.
Staying up to date with regular maintenance is important for preventing damages and injuries from tough and massive falling palm branches.
Pine Tree Pruning
The best time to cut back your pine trees is during the very first part of springtime, but if at any time you discover dying or diseased branches, it's a good idea to deal with those.
Applying proper pruning methods is truly essential.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is honestly a bad idea due to the fact that it could prevent the branch from growing completely. That can leave the branch stunted and off balance permanently.
In the springtime when the pine tree starts to grow out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and dense growth that is notably appealing.
